Cooking Tips and Notes

When preparing your Easy Chicken Noodle Soup, a few helpful tips can elevate your cooking experience and the final dish. First, always start with a good quality broth as it serves as the foundation for your soup’s flavor. Opt for low-sodium chicken broth if you prefer to control the salt content, allowing you to season to taste later.

Sautéing Vegetables

Sautéing the onion, carrots, and celery in olive oil until softened is crucial. This step not only enhances the flavors but also ensures that the vegetables are tender and well-integrated into the soup. Don’t rush this step; give them the time they need to develop a rich, aromatic base.

Timing the Noodles

When adding the egg noodles, be mindful of their cooking time. Since they cook quickly, add them towards the end to prevent them from becoming mushy. If you’re planning to store leftovers, consider cooking the noodles separately and adding them just before serving. This way, they maintain their ideal texture.

Flavor Enhancements

For an extra layer of flavor, a splash of lemon juice just before serving can brighten the soup and balance the richness of the broth. Additionally, experimenting with fresh herbs or spices can personalize the dish to your liking.

How long does Easy Chicken Noodle Soup last in the fridge?

This soup can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 5 days, making it a great option for meal prep or leftovers. Just be sure to store it in an airtight container to maintain freshness.

Can I freeze Easy Chicken Noodle Soup?

Yes, you can freeze the soup! However, it’s best to add the noodles after thawing to prevent them from becoming mushy. Store the soup in freezer-safe containers for up to three months.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 carrots, sliced
  • 2 celery stalks, sliced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 8 cups chicken broth
  • 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on dried parsley
  • 8 ounces egg noodles
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ley for garnish


Instructions

  1.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
  2. Add the onion, carrots, and celery; sauté until softened.
  3. Stir in garlic and cook for another minute.
  4. Pour in the chicken broth and bring to a boil.
  5. Add cooked chicken, thyme, and parsley; simmer for 10 minutes.
  6. Stir in egg noodles and cook until tender.
  7.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  8.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.

Notes

  • This soup can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
  • For a richer flavor, add a splash of lemon juice before serving.
